The 2024âÂÂ25 Premier Volleyball League (PVL) season was the eighth season of the Premier Volleyball League. As the league began aligning its calendar with the FIVB calendar, this was the first season to take place in two different calendar years. The season began on November 9, 2024 and ended on November 30, 2025.
This season features the first edition of the PVL on Tour Conference, which is held to accommodate the Philippines' hosting of the 2025 FIVB Men's Volleyball World Championship. For the first time, the league sent its top teams to compete in the AVC Women's Volleyball Champions League after previous attempts fell through.
The first conference of the season was the All-Filipino Conference which began on November 9, 2024 and ended on April 12, 2025. With a duration of six months, it is currently the longest conference in league history. The top teams in this conference qualified for the 2025 AVC Women's Volleyball Champions League.
The 2025 Premier Volleyball League draft was held on June 8, 2025, at Novotel Manila Araneta City in Quezon City. The first pick was made by the Capital1 Solar Spikers.
After the All-Filipino Conference, the league held a "preseason" tournament to make way for the Philippines' hosting of the 2025 FIVB Men's Volleyball World Championship. That conference was the PVL on Tour, based on the league's out-of-town series of the same name, which began on June 22, 2025 and ended on August 17. The tournament also doubled as a qualifier for the Invitational Conference.

The second conference of the season was the Invitational Conference which began on August 21, 2025 and ended on August 31.
The third conference of the season is the Reinforced Conference which began on October 7, 2025 and is set to end on November 30.
